Abstract

Urban flooding,due to climate change and rapid urbanization, has become a great challenge for Jinan City. In the present study,Infoworks ICM model was used to simulate rainstorm waterlog in piedmont plains of Jinan. One-dimensional stormwater network model and two-dimensional waterlog model were developed to simulate flood inundation for observed and design rainfalls with different return periods. Distributions of inundation nodes were recorded. Simulation results were compared with actual inundation hydrograph, with the model error further analyzed. Occurrence times of maximum water depth at station mesh for one-and two-dimensional models were found to be 21:50 and 20:05,respectively, consistent with actual records. The two-dimensional modeling results showed that maximum water depth was 0.078 which agreed well with observed values. The two-dimensional model performed better in simulations. Rainfall event on2015-08-03 had a 5 year frequency according to two-dimensional model. One-dimensional model may underestimate inundation. An historical stormwater flood was simulated, design rainfalls with different periods were further simulated,the sources of model error was then analyzed. This work will provide some scientific basis for flood control and disaster reduction, and for the construction of "sponge city" in Jinan.
